分簇及局部优化的无线传感器网络拓扑控制算法

摘    要:为保证网络连通性和覆盖度的情况下,尽量合理、高效地使用网络能量,延长网络生命周期,提出一种基于分簇和局部优化的拓扑控制(cluster and local optimization topology control,CLTC)算法.基于树型网络模型,利用分簇思想将网络分割为不同的簇,簇内运用最小生成树算法,确定邻居节点关系,降低节点通信碰撞;簇间通过簇头连接,形成优化的骨干网络拓扑.仿真实验表明,运行CLTC算法,构建网络拓扑结构快速,通信开销小,可以有效降低节点平均能耗,延长网络周期.

关 键 词:无线传感器网络  拓扑  分簇  最小生成树
